Job Summary
The Director of Regional Sales is accountable for leading enterprise revenue growth across an assigned geographic region, from pipeline creation through closed business. This role exists to build a high-performing regional sales presence that consistently converts new enterprise logos and expands existing relationships in a competitive, channel-driven cybersecurity market.
Role Overview
As Director of Regional Sales, you will own the full enterprise sales motion across your region: setting strategy, driving execution, and personally leading complex, high-value pursuits. You will be the senior commercial voice in the region: engaging at the executive level with CISOs, CIOs, and security architects; orchestrating cross-functional resources including Sales Engineering, Marketing, and Customer Success; and developing the regional channel ecosystem as a force multiplier for pipeline and revenue. Success in this role requires the ability to operate simultaneously as a strategic leader and a high-output individual contributor.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and execute a comprehensive regional sales strategy aligned to ColorTokens’s go-to-market priorities, targeting enterprise accounts with $1B+ in revenue across key verticals including financial services, insurance, healthcare, life sciences, manufacturing, and energy.
- Lead the full enterprise sales cycle, from prospecting and discovery through proposal, proof of value, negotiation, and close, with consistent execution against MEDDPICC qualification standards.
- Build and manage a qualified pipeline with sufficient coverage to meet and exceed regional revenue targets; maintain accurate CRM hygiene and deliver evidence-based forecasts in Salesforce.
- Engage credibly at the executive level with CISOs, CIOs, VP of Architecture, and VP of Cloud, positioning ColorTokens as a strategic partner for Zero Trust and Microsegmentation initiatives.
- Develop outcome-based proposals that translate ColorTokens’s technical capabilities into measurable business value: reduced blast radius, ransomware containment, OT protection, and compliance readiness.
- Recruit, enable, and leverage regional channel partners as a force multiplier for pipeline generation and deal execution; coordinate joint go-to-market activities and manage partner relationships through closed revenue.
- Manage proof-of-value engagements with defined success criteria, structured timelines, and executive readouts to prevent scope creep and maintain deal control.
- Analyze market trends, competitive positioning, and customer insights to identify growth opportunities and adapt regional strategy accordingly.
- Collaborate cross-functionally with Sales Engineering, Marketing, Customer Success, and Product to ensure a seamless customer experience and support strategic account expansion.
- Represent ColorTokens at client meetings, industry events, and networking opportunities to build regional presence and brand awareness.
Required Skills & Qualifications
- 10+ years of enterprise cybersecurity sales experience, with a demonstrated history of acquiring new logos in complex, technical, and consultative sales environments.
- 3+ years of managing regional sales teams.
- Proven track record of selling into enterprises with $1B+ in revenue, managing multi-stakeholder deals, and closing six- and seven-figure transactions.
- Deep cybersecurity domain expertise, with specific knowledge of network security, firewall architecture, and the limitations that drive the business case for micro segmentation.
- Demonstrated ability to engage as a peer with senior security and technology executives including CISOs, CIOs, and VPs of Architecture.
- Experience building and leveraging regional channel partner ecosystems, including resellers, GSIs, and security domain specialist partners.
- Strong command of MEDDPICC or equivalent enterprise qualification methodology; experience managing structured proof-of-value engagements.
- Proficiency in Salesforce for pipeline management, forecasting, and opportunity documentation.
- Familiarity with regulated verticals such as financial services, healthcare, manufacturing, energy, or MedTech is a strong advantage.
- Bachelor’s degree in business, marketing, or an IT-related field, or equivalent experience.
- Must be located in Eastern US. Willingness to travel at least 50%. Must possess a valid driver’s license.
